Water Damage
The rubber seals on the key fob protect the chip's electronic components from water. If it is able to withstand a short splash from a washing-machine or just a brief dip in light rain, it's unlikely to be damaged. If you've dropped it in the pool or in the ocean, the water could get into the seals and damage the circuit board, which can be expensive to repair.
The first step is drying the key fob thoroughly. This can be accomplished in many ways. You can place it in a plastic bag with silica gel packets that will absorb the moisture out of it. Alternately, you can use rice that has not been cooked, but it is important not to contact the key fob when it's still wet as this could contaminate the internal components.
You can also clean the contacts of the circuit board by using isopropyl or electronic cleaner. If, however, the chip is fried, it's probably best to accept that you'll require a replacement key fob.

The throttle position sensor (TPS), which is located in the i20, could fail. This sensor is used to determine the opening angle of throttle valve. The information is then sent to the control unit that is used to calculate the amount of fuel required. A malfunctioning throttle sensor can cause jerky acceleration, RPM fluctuations and a decrease in engine performance.
Transmission issues are another frequent issue with i20s. The transmission is a complicated component that has many gears that connect to transfer power from the engine to wheels. As time passes the friction between gears can cause the transmission's failure. Grinding or clunking sounds and rapid acceleration that is jerky are signs of an unreliable gearbox.
The spark plugs on the i20 are another frequent problem area. Spark plugs that are defective can cause damage to the engine because they do not deliver the right amount of sparks to every cylinder. If they are not checked a damaged spark plug could cause serious and expensive engine damage.
